In the quest for maintaining a strong and resilient cardiovascular system, natural supplements have gained significant attention. Three supplements that have been frequently inquired about are Arterosil, Emu Oil, and OptiLipid. Each of these supplements proposes unique mechanisms for potentially reducing the risk of heart attacks and strokes.

Arterosil

Derived from the rare green seaweed Monostroma nitidum, Arterosil contains the key compound rhamnan sulfate. This marine polysaccharide is known for its ability to support the endothelium and glycocalyx, which are crucial for vascular health. By nourishing and protecting these layers, Arterosil can improve endothelial function, potentially reducing arterial stiffness and improving blood flow [5].

Emu Oil

Emu Oil, sourced from 100% pasture-raised emus in Australia, is less commonly cited specifically for heart attack or stroke prevention. Primarily known for its anti-inflammatory and skin-healing properties, its benefits for cardiovascular health would likely be more general anti-inflammatory support rather than direct prevention of vascular events.

OptiLipid

OptiLipid is a supplement designed to support heart health through a combination of omega-3 fatty acids, antioxidants, and vitamins. Omega-3s can reduce triglycerides, lower blood pressure, reduce blood clotting, and decrease inflammation, all of which help prevent heart attacks and strokes.

Apart from these, garlic supplements are also mentioned for their heart-healthy sulfur compounds that support cardiovascular health [1][2]. Niacin (vitamin B3), although not asked about, is referenced as improving blood flow and aiding heart health by causing a flushing effect due to vasodilation, which can improve circulation [4].

In summary, Arterosil works by protecting the vascular lining at a cellular level, OptiLipid mainly influences lipid profiles and inflammation, and Emu Oil lacks direct cardiovascular preventive mechanisms based on available evidence. This assessment is based on current available information, mostly for Arterosil and OptiLipid; more robust clinical studies would be needed to fully confirm each supplement’s efficacy in preventing heart attacks and strokes.
